One of the primary benefits of conveyor belt washing systems is improved sanitation. Over time, conveyor belts can accumulate a build-up of dirt, debris, and bacteria, creating a breeding ground for contamination. This can be especially concerning in industries such as food processing, where cleanliness is essential to prevent the spread of foodborne illnesses. By regularly cleaning conveyor belts with a washing system, companies can ensure that their products meet rigorous hygiene standards and protect consumers from potential health risks.
In addition to enhancing sanitation, conveyor belt washing systems can also improve product quality. When conveyor belts are dirty or oily, there is a higher risk of product contamination, which can lead to costly recalls and damage to a company’s reputation. By removing contaminants with a washing system, companies can reduce the likelihood of product spoilage and ensure that their products meet quality control standards. This results in higher customer satisfaction and increased profitability for the business.
Furthermore, conveyor belt washing systems can also extend the lifespan of conveyor belts. Over time, dirt and grime can cause wear and tear on conveyor belts, leading to premature breakdowns and costly repairs. By regularly cleaning conveyor belts with a washing system, companies can prevent excessive wear and extend the life of their equipment. This not only saves money on maintenance and replacement costs but also minimizes downtime and production interruptions, leading to increased productivity and efficiency.
Another key benefit of conveyor belt washing systems is worker safety. Dirty or oily conveyor belts can create slippery surfaces, increasing the risk of accidents and injuries for employees working on the production line. By keeping conveyor belts clean with a washing system, companies can create a safer work environment and reduce the likelihood of workplace injuries. This not only protects the well-being of employees but also reduces workers’ compensation claims and related costs for the company.
